Do’s And Don’ts For Homeowners Managing With Water Damage
Though water provides life, water breach on parts where it's not expected to be can lead to damages. If the water saturates right into your framework, it can peel off away surface areas and also deteriorate the foundation. Mold as well as mildew likewise thrive in a wet atmosphere, which can be dangerous for your health. Residences with water damages smell mildewy and also old.

Water can come from several resources such as hurricanes, floods, burst pipelines, leaks, and also drain issues. In case you experience water damages, it would be good to recognize some security precautions. Below are a couple of guidelines on how to take care of water damage.

Do Prioritize Residence Insurance Coverage Coverage



Water damage from flooding dues to hefty winds is seasonal. You can likewise experience a sudden flood when a faulty pipe suddenly breaks into your home. It would certainly be best to have home insurance policy that covers both acts of God such as all-natural catastrophes, as well as emergency situations like damaged plumbing.

Do Not Fail To Remember to Shut Off Utilities



In case of a calamity, particularly if you stay in a flood-prone location, it would certainly be advisable to shut off the main electrical circuit. This cuts off power to your entire home, preventing electrical shocks when water is available in as it is a conductor. Do not forget to transform off the major water line shutoff. When floodwaters are high, furnishings will certainly move as well as create damage. Having the main valve shut down avoids more damages.

Do Keep Proactive and Heed Climate Alerts



Storm floods can be very uncertain. Remain positive and ready if there is a history of flooding in your area. If you live near a river, creek, or lake , listen to emptying warnings. Get valuables from the very beginning and also basement, after that placed them on the highest feasible level. Doing so decreases potential home damage.

Do Not Overlook the Roofing System



You can avoid rainfall damages if there are no openings as well as leaks in your roof. This will certainly protect against water from flowing down your wall surfaces and soaking your ceiling.

Do Take Notice Of Little Leakages



A burst pipeline does not take place over night. Generally, there are warnings that suggest you have compromised pipelines in your house. You might discover gurgling paint, peeling wallpaper, water streaks, water spots, or dripping audios behind the walls. Ultimately, this pipe will break. Preferably, you ought to not await things to escalate. Have your plumbing repaired prior to it results in huge damages.

Do Not Panic in Case of a Burst Pipe



When it comes to water damage, timing is essential. Therefore, if a pipeline bursts in your residence, quickly shut off your main water shutoff to reduce off the source. Call a trusted water damages restoration specialist for assistance.

Some Do's & Don't When Dealing with a Water Damage


DO:




  • Make sure the water source has been eliminated. Contact a plumber if needed.


  • Turn off circuit breakers supplying electricity to wet areas and unplug any electronics that are on wet carpet or surfaces


  • Remove small furniture items


  • Remove as much excess water as possible by mopping or blotting; Use WHITE towels to blot wet carpeting


  • Wipe water from wooden furniture after removing anything on it


  • Remove and prop up wet upholstery cushions for even drying (check for any bleeding)


  • Pin up curtains or furniture skirts if needed


  • Place aluminum foil, saucers or wood blocks between furniture legs and wet carpet


  • Turn on air conditioning for maximum drying in winter and open windows in the summer


  • Open any drawers and cabinets affected for complete drying but do not force them open


  • Remove any valuable art objects or paintings to a safe, dry place


  • Open any suitcases or luggage that may have been affected to dry, preferably in sunlight


  • Hang any fur or leather goods to dry at room temperature


  • Punch small holes in sagging ceilings to relieve trapped water (don't forget to place pans beneath!); however, if the ceiling is sagging extremely low, stay out of the room and we'll take care of it

  • DO NOT:


  • Leave wet fabrics in place; dry them as soon as possible


  • Leave books, magazines or any other colored items on wet carpets or floor


  • Use your household vacuum to remove water


  • Use TV's or other electronics/appliances while standing on wet carpets or floors; especially not on wet concrete floors


  • Turn on ceiling fixtures if the ceiling is wet


  • Turn your heat up, unless instructed otherwise
